We’re putting together plans for the FLCA Turkey Trot. Like last year, it will be on private property up in Palatka. The difference being, it will be the weekend BEFORE Thanksgiving. That’s Nov. 22 – 24. It’s the only time the property will be available.

You can camp on the property Saturday and Sunday nights if you want to, or just come on Saturday for a day of playing and contests. Take a look at last year’s Turkey Trot http://www.flca.org/Meetings/meetfram.htm , there will be more of this as well as other obstacles and a trail or two. The Saturday evening meal will be provided by the FLCA, followed by a great raffle.
